Page 5: ... and 30 vol in the air Due to the high ignition energy and temperature the risk of explosion however is rated as low So there are no special explosion protection measures are required However the national safety regulations accident prevention regulations technical regulations as well as specific regulations EN 378 etc must be observed NH3 steam is lighter than air and therefore disperses upwards ...

Page 9: ...ywhen operating near to the threshold When operating in the vacuum range there is a danger of air entering on the suction side This can cause chemical reactions a pressure rise in the condenser and an elevated compressed gas temperature Prevent the ingress of air at all costs The compressors are filled with the following oil type at the factory for R134a R404A R507 R407C FUCHS Reniso Triton SE 55 ...

Page 19: ...ENTION Failure to observe the following instructions can cause loss of refrigerant and damage to the shaft seal INFO The shaft seal seals and lubricates with oil An oil leakage of 0 05 ml per operating hour is therefore normal This applies particularly during the run in phase 200 300 h The compressor types F14 and F16 are equipped with a leak oil drain hose see chapter 10 and 11 The leak oil is co...

Page 21: ...ed in the factory not mandatory In field installations or operating in the application limit range first oil change after approx 100 200 operating hours then approx every 3 years or 10 000 12 000 operating hours for NH3 plants oil change every year or every 5 000 operating hours Dispose of old oil according to the regulations observe national regulations Annual checks Oil level tightness running n...
